A Baker plays a crucial role in the culinary industry, specializing in the creation and production of a wide variety of breads, pastries, and other baked goods. Typically working in bakeries, restaurants, or hotels, they are responsible for mixing ingredients following recipes, shaping and forming dough, setting oven temperatures, and decorating and presenting baked goods attractively. They must also ensure the quality of the ingredients and maintain cleanliness and sanitation in their workstation. Bakers often work closely with chefs to design and develop new recipes.
Key skills for a Baker include attention to detail, creativity, physical stamina, and the ability to work independently or as part of a team. Excellent time management skills are also essential, as baking often involves tight schedules and precise timing. In terms of qualifications, although some bakers learn their trade through work experience, many employers prefer candidates with a diploma or degree in baking and pastry arts. Additionally, certification from a recognized culinary institution, such as the Retail Bakers of America, can enhance career prospects. Prior to becoming a Baker, a person may have roles such as a Bakery Assistant, where they assist in basic baking and cleaning tasks, a Pastry Cook, preparing pastries in a restaurant, or a Bread Baker Apprentice, learning the trade under a professional Baker.
